Beschreibung
Zusammenfassung:We investigate the Berry phase for quantum spin system in q-deformed magnetic field. Through the q-deformed Lie algebra, we found a set of magnetic field expressions which contain the parameter q. The Berry phase of the system could be adjusted by the parameter q. The corresponding general formula of the q-deformed Berry phase is presented for an arbitrary spin system. The same Hamiltonian can also be generated from the Wigner D-function which satisfies the Yang-Baxter equation.
